'An Evening with Adam Sandler' at the Riverside in April with special guest Rob Schneider

MILWAUKEE -- Adam Sandler is coming to Milwaukee April 18 and 19 with special guest Rob Schneider.

"An Evening With Adam Sandler" is coming to the Riverside Theater for the two shows. Doors open at 7 p.m. and the shows begin at 8.

According to a news release from Pabst Theater officials, Sandler is a successful actor, writer, producer and musician, Sandler’s films have grossed over $3 billion worldwide and include box office hits such as “Grown Ups,” “Big Daddy,” “The Longest Yard,” and “The Waterboy.” Sandler’s last three films for Netflix, “The Ridiculous 6,” “The Do-Over,” and “Sandy Wexler,” have been the most-watched films on Netflix to-date. His most recent film, directed by Noah Buambach “The Meyerowitz Stories,” was loved by audiences and critics alike. This April, Sandler co-stars in the Netflix comedy, “The Week Of,” reuniting him with friend and SNL alumni, Chris Rock.”  After a long absence from the comedy stage, Sandler has found time between films over the last couple of years to perform in front of live audiences in a sold-out tour in the U.S. and Canada.
